Abstract

Tengger is one of the tribes on the island of Java, especially East Java. As the general public knows, the Tengger tribe has its daily language, namely Tengger language. Even though this tribe is located in the middle of an area that experiences language mixing, the Tengger tribe still uses their language in everyday life. This is a special attraction for the people of Tengger apart from its tourist attractions. The language, which more or less still uses Old Javanese, is an interesting object to research, one of which is the word affixes used in the Tengger language. This affixation research also involves affixations used in the old Javanese in Wedhawati’s book. This research examines three affixations: prefixes, infixes, and suffixes. prefixes are word affixes that are at the beginning of words, infixes are word affixes that are in the middle of words, and suffixes are word affixes that are at the end of words. This research uses a qualitative descriptive approach to analyze the problem. The research was carried out using the interview method so that researchers could understand what affixations are used in the Tengger language. Analysis of research data was obtained by studying affixations in the Tengger language. After obtaining data results from sources, this research validated the data with people who were experts in the Tengger language. The results of data analysis from affixations in the Tengger language can be concluded that ten types of prefixes were found in the Tengger language, namely {di-, N-, kə-, neʔ-, mə-, digə-, ka-, pi-, paN-, taʔ-}. Two infixes from the data analysis results are {-əl-}, and {-əm-}. Seven suffixes are found in the Tengger language: {-an, -nan, e, -ne, -a, -ən, -ana}. So, the total are 19 kinds of affixes found in the Tengger language, which include 10 prefixes, 2 infixes, and 7 suffixes. There are prefixes {m-}, {ŋ-}, {n}, {ɲ-} are the allomorph of {-N}. Suffix {-an} and {-nan} are the allomorph of {-an}. Suffix {-e} and {-ne} are the allomorph of suffix {-ne}.
